Penske: IndyCar sure to investigate wheel that flew over stands from Indy 500 wreck

Por: WPLG Local 10 Sports May 30, 2023

thumbnail

INDIANAPOLIS – IndyCar owner Roger Penske says he is certain series officials will investigate what led to a wheel coming loose during a crash in the Indianapolis 500, which ended up sailing over the catch fence and grandstands before landing on a parked automobile.“We haven't had a wheel come off in a long time,” Penske said. “We were very fortunate we didn't have a bad accident.”The cars are supposed to have a tether that... + full article
